History

Established in 1862 in the heart of the UK, Dudley College is a leader in vocational training. We support over 14,000 learners and 1,500 employers from across the world. We’re renowned for our expertise in areas that include leadership and management training, skills development, employer engagement, employability and teacher development.

Library services

Broadway campus has a ground floor library containing books and other material appropriate to the subjects taught on all campuses. They also provide a lending, reference and information service run by qualified staff. With seating provided for over 200, the libraries hold a combined total of over 55,000 volumes, most of which may be borrowed.

Student clubs

When you enrol with us you automatically become a member of Dudley College Students’ Union. This democratic organisation is independent from the college and led by elected students who are passionate about representing students' voices. Membership is free and designed to help you get the best from your time here – both academically and socially.
